Form 4: Patterson Companies COO Kevin Pohlman Reports Stock Transactions and Holdings
SEC Form 4 Filing
Patterson Companies' Chief Operating Officer, Kevin Pohlman, reported the withholding of 420 shares to cover tax liabilities and disclosed holdings of common stock, restricted stock units, and employee stock options.
Summary
- Kevin Pohlman, Chief Operating Officer of Patterson Companies, reported a transaction on December 13, 2024, where 420 shares of common stock were withheld to cover tax obligations related to the vesting of restricted stock units.
- Following this transaction, Mr. Pohlman directly owns 157,297 shares of common stock.
- He also indirectly owns 1,923 shares through the company's Employee Stock Ownership Plan (ESOP).
- Mr. Pohlman holds 40,688 restricted stock units (RSUs) that will vest over the next few years, with 14,208 vesting on July 1, 2025, 2,692 on December 15, 2025, 13,385 on July 1, 2026, and 10,403 on July 1, 2027.
- Additionally, he holds various employee stock options granted between 2017 and 2023, with different exercise prices and vesting schedules, totaling 156,699 options.
